Gabapentin
Anticonvulsant used for neuropathic pain and seizures.
Gabapentin, sold under the brand name Neurontin among others, is an anticonvulsant medication used to treat neuropathic pain (postherpetic neuralgia) and partial seizures of epilepsy. It is a central nervous system depressant and derivative of the inhibitory neurotransmitter GABA, and it binds to α2δ subunits to modulate calcium channel function and neurotransmitter release.

Lore & Background
Gabapentin is a gabapentinoid, the first of several drugs similar in structure and mechanism. It is moderately effective for diabetic neuropathy and postherpetic neuralgia, with about 30–40% of patients experiencing meaningful benefit. It is also used off-label for conditions such as anxiety disorders, sleep problems, and bipolar disorder, though evidence for some off-label uses is limited. During the 1990s, Parke-Davis, a subsidiary of Pfizer, used illegal techniques to encourage off-label prescribing, resulting in millions of dollars in lawsuit settlements.

Approved Indications & Clinical Efficacy
Gabapentin, marketed under the brand name Neurontin and others, occupies a distinctive position in modern pharmacology as a central nervous system depressant derived from the inhibitory neurotransmitter GABA. Its approved clinical territory is relatively narrow: in the United States it is indicated for postherpetic neuralgia and as an adjunctive treatment for partial-onset seizures that do not secondarily generalize. Medical authorities broadly recommend it as a first-line agent for chronic neuropathic pain across most syndromes, though it steps back to a second- or third-line role in trigeminal neuralgia. Systematic reviews confirm meaningful pain relief for a subset of patients with diabetic neuropathy and postherpetic neuralgia, with roughly thirty to forty percent experiencing a clinically significant benefit. It also shows effectiveness for central pain and, when paired with an opioid or nortriptyline, may outperform either agent used alone. Conversely, the evidence is sobering in other contexts: it offers little to no advantage for chronic low back pain, sciatica, HIV-associated sensory neuropathy, or cancer-related neuropathic pain, and it simply does not work for generalized epilepsy.
Mechanism of Action & Safety Landscape
Despite its structural relationship to GABA, gabapentin does not actually engage GABA receptors. Instead, it latches onto the α2δ subunits of voltage-gated calcium channels, thereby modulating calcium influx and the subsequent release of neurotransmitters. It also exerts a weak influence on glutamate signaling pathways. This pharmacological profile helps explain why its therapeutic effects are relatively modest compared with classic GABAergic agents. On the safety front, the most frequently reported adverse effects are drowsiness and dizziness. More serious complications include profound sedation, respiratory depression, and hypersensitivity or allergic reactions. Market Trajectory & the Parke-Davis Scandal
Gabapentin's journey from laboratory compound to one of the most widely dispensed drugs in America is both remarkable and, in parts, controversial. Its popularity has grown particularly among elderly patients in recent years. Yet the drug's expansion into off-label territory was not always organic. During the 1990s, Parke-Davis, a subsidiary of Pfizer, employed several illegal promotional techniques to push physicians toward prescribing gabapentin for unapproved indications. The company ultimately paid out millions of dollars in settlements to resolve the resulting lawsuits. Today, clinicians and regulators express growing concern that the breadth of off-label use—spanning non-neuropathic pain, anxiety, sleep disturbances, and bipolar disorder—outpaces the strength of the underlying scientific evidence, while the drug's side-effect profile and potential for misuse and dependency remain underappreciated.
Dependence, Withdrawal & Unresolved Questions
Gabapentin's role in substance-use medicine is nuanced and, in many respects, still being defined. It is moderately effective at easing the symptoms of alcohol withdrawal and reducing associated cravings, though the evidence does not support its use for achieving abstinence or preventing relapse into heavy drinking; it merely lowers the proportion of days with heavy consumption. For cocaine dependence, methamphetamine use, and smoking cessation, it has proven ineffective. The picture with opioids is more complex: some studies report no significant benefit during withdrawal, yet a growing body of evidence suggests gabapentinoids can help manage certain withdrawal symptoms. A clinical trial conducted in Iran, where heroin dependence poses a major public-health burden, found positive outcomes in an inpatient setting, particularly in reducing opioid-induced hyperalgesia and drug craving. Cannabis dependence remains an area with insufficient data. Prolonged use at higher doses carries a real risk of discontinuation and withdrawal symptoms, and published trials have been criticized for underreporting nervous-system harms, potentially skewing clinical guidelines.
